Usage

Ideally you will run cli-cast and say, "Wow! Everything 'just works!'" Inquirer is intended to handle the actual CLI UX of updating an XML feed, whereas Commander is gonna be all like, ooh, look at me, I'm a real CLI application.

The GOAL here, JEFFREY, is to allow a podcast author slash server admin to ssh into a server, scp a new podcast episode into a web-facing directory, and run cli-cast to update the show's XML (or to generate it if the show is new).

Later versions of the software might allow you to edit the podcast feed directly from the command line (to change the description, amend episode metadata, et al) or do other cool things. The sky is truly the limit for this application I am making up.

Generation of the website surrounding the podcast feed and other such podcast meta-maintenance are facets of an overall exercise left to the aforementioned podcast author slash server admin.
